        Pros

        There's only just a couple pros of working here. However, the individual employees were absolutely amazing. I received stunning support from my immediate team leaders. I'd like to stress that my immediate coworkers and some of the line managers were wonderful, overworked and underpaid people. Regardless, they did a great job in understanding the staff's situations and did their best to accommodate for them the best they could. Relatively easy to schedule time off. On the outside, the company looks great. Upper management had us put a wishlist together for Christmas and chose items off of said list to mail us. I'd say that was a great gesture there. If you'd like to integrate yourself further within the company, the company does have channels in which the staff can use to speak about general out of work things such as travel, gaming, pets, etc.

        Cons

        Unfortunately, there's just too many downsides to list. I generally try to keep an open mind and strive to do my best at any job that I have. It was extremely difficult here. Like others have said, the pay is absolutely abysmal and only increased when the state minimum wage was raised. If you're looking for a raise in pay, it's unfortunately unlikely. Although The Chat Shop pushes for a "positive" and "modern" working culture, the general opinion from the actual staff of upper management is extremely negative. Regardless of the forms that was put out, little to no feedback from the staff was listened to or addressed. This company unfortunately has a tendency to release its workers without any notice, especially during merges between teams. Being that this is a UK based company, it is extremely easy for this company to let go of individuals that are not located within the UK. Despite communication with immediate line managers, mistakes (big or small) are typically all written down and viewed by upper management without considering any positives an individual might've done. IE, picking up urgent shifts that are not covered or staying late as another agent no called or no showed. Their chat structure is atrocious. You may or may not be the either the only agent, or one of the 2-3 agents online when over 100 clients are active. Overall, it always felt like your individual future at the company was never guaranteed in that it wasn't uncommon to hear that previous managers that were still employed there had been demoted multiple times. Suggestions and feedback were heard and typically agreed with by immediate managers. However, upper management is incredibly out of touch with reality. Everything will be in UK time including the times that your shifts are posted. After some research, the company hasn't changed this for its U.S. workers despite feedback. My exit call lasted exactly 3 minutes until it was cut short when my google account was suspended when a representative of upper management suspended my account prematurely. I was not able to complete the rest of the call and did not hear back from them thereafter.

                      The Chat Shop Reviews FAQs

                      The Chat Shop has an overall rating of 3.7 out of 5, based on over 110 reviews left anonymously by employees. 75% of employees would recommend working at The Chat Shop to a friend and 71% have a positive outlook for the business. This rating has improved by 1% over the last 12 months.

                      According to anonymously submitted Glassdoor reviews, The Chat Shop employees rate their compensation and benefits as 3.3 out of 5. Find out more about salaries and benefits at The Chat Shop. This rating has improved by 5% over the last 12 months.

                      75% of The Chat Shop employees would recommend working there to a friend based on Glassdoor reviews. Employees also rated The Chat Shop 3.9 out of 5 for work life balance, 3.7 for culture and values and 3.4 for career opportunities.

                      According to reviews on Glassdoor, employees commonly mention the pros of working at The Chat Shop to be benefits, management, career development and the cons to be compensation .
